    I had heard mixed reviews about this sushi restaurant but had to find out for myself. The atmosphere was very cozy and gave a traditional feel to the restaurant. The staff were very polite and our waitress came straight to the table to take our order. The miso soup was very standard and not as flavorful as some other restaurants I have tried. The drink was absolutely delicious and had the perfect balance of sweet and alcohol. The sushi rolls were ON POINT. You can immediately tell that all of the ingredients are fresh and put together perfectly. Overall this was a cute little stop for our days adventure.

    Made a reservation on Wednesday at 6:30 p.m. There were still a lot of open tables during that time, but started to fill up quickly. It was very clean inside. I loved the overhead hanging bamboo. This isn't described in the menu that the Masa classic woks and Masa specialty entrees come with a choice of either white or brown rice and a soup or salad. Dishes such as the Masa fried rice and Masa chow fun come with a combination of all the high protein foods. Started off with the vegetable roll, which is vegan and comes with tofu skin and a variety of vegetables. This was good and I would get it again. I tried one of the Masa specialty entrees, Shaking Beef with brown rice and salad with ginger dressing. The shaking beef dish was good, particularly with hot sauce. The beef was tender and the sauce was a thick sweet brown sauce. The sauce is described in the menu as their famous black pepper sauce, which is not spicy at all, to me anyway. The only chili sauce they had was Sriracha. It was nice they gave me extra brown sauce for the dish, even though I didn't ask for it. I liked the abundance and variety of veggies that came with the dish. I wasn't able to finish the whole dish. This house side salad was good overall, just simple chopped lettuce and julienned carrots. The ginger salad dressing wasn't the best ginger dressing I've ever had though. The waiter was very nice and helpful in picking out dishes. This is a good spot to check out if you're looking for a place to eat while shopping at the mall.

    I was in the Independence mall area and decided it was time to eat and saw there were a few places that were new to the area. Masa Sushi was one and when I looked up their menu I saw they had some awesome lunch specials. It is a smaller location, so if you are going during peak times, it would be wise to get a reservation. For lunch, it was fine and had a handful of tables taken. I sat at the bar and was able to order fairly quickly. The bartender pointed out a few things and I ended up going with the Sushi Lunch special and a cocktail. The cocktail was made with Sake and was super delicious and for the lunch special, you get TWO rolls and it was $12. That also included a soup or salad. The lunch was well worth the money. I do wish there were a few other choices to choose from but overall it was pretty great.
